Abstract
Solvent extraction of65zinc,60cobalt and152+154europium from aqueous buffers into benzene containing 4-thiobenzoyl-2,4-dihydro-5-methyl-2-phenyl-3H-pyrazol-3-one (SBMPP) has been investigated in detail (μ=0.1, T=26±1°C). The species extracted and the values of log Kex, where Kex refers to the extraction equilibrium, are ZnL2 (−2.68) CoL2(−3.08) and EuL3(−7.08), where L is the anion of the ligand. The sulfur analog appears to be more effective than the parent ligand 4-benzoyl-2,4-dihydro-5-methyl-2-phenyl-3H-pyrazol-3-one in the extraction of zinc(II) and cobalt(II), whereas the reverse is true with europium(III).
